gcr.io/uber-container-tools/kraken-testfs 是一个 Docker 容器镜像,从命名和存储路径来看,它很可能是 Uber 公司技术团队开发的工具,主要用于其内部分布式存储系统 Kraken 的测试场景。
Docker 容器镜像的特性是能打包应用代码、运行环境及依赖,实现跨环境一致部署,这让它非常适合作为测试工具——开发或测试人员无需手动配置复杂的底层环境,直接拉取镜像就能快速启动测试实例。结合 Kraken 是 Uber 自研的分布式存储系统(这类系统通常用于处理大规模数据存储、高并发读写等场景),这个镜像的核心作用,很可能是为 Kraken 的开发迭代提供标准化的文件系统测试环境。
具体来说,它可能模拟了 Kraken 运行时涉及的各类文件系统场景:比如模拟不同大小的文件写入、高频次数据读写请求、网络延迟或节点故障等异常情况,帮助测试人员验证 Kraken 在实际运行中的稳定性、数据一致性、容错能力等关键指标。分布式存储系统的测试往往复杂,需要覆盖多种边缘场景,而通过容器镜像封装特定测试逻辑和环境,能大幅降低测试准备成本,让团队更专注于验证系统功能是否达标。
不过,这类内部工具的具体设计细节(比如支持的测试用例类型、是否包含特定数据生成工具、如何与 Kraken 集群交互等),通常不会对外公开,需要参考 Uber 内部技术文档才能完全明确。但从“testfs”(test file system,测试文件系统)的后缀推测,它的核心价值应聚焦于为 Kraken 的文件系统层提供便捷、可复现的测试支持,助力这套存储系统在上线前充分暴露潜在问题,保障大规模数据存储的可靠性。
请登录使用轩辕镜像享受快速拉取体验,支持国内访问优化,速度提升
docker pull gcr.io/uber-container-tools/kraken-testfs:v0.1.1manifest unknown 错误
TLS 证书验证失败
DNS 解析超时
410 错误:版本过低
402 错误:流量耗尽
身份认证失败错误
429 限流错误
凭证保存错误
来自真实用户的反馈,见证轩辕镜像的优质服务